该文通过筛选当归中对NF-κB具有抑制活性的质量标志物(Q-marker),建立了一种利用近红外光谱技术(NIRS)快速评价当归抗炎功效的方法。采用UPLC/Q-TOF技术结合NF-κB双荧光素酶报告基因对当归中具有NF-κB抑制活性的成分进行筛选,并通过单体、整体及等效性验证确立了关键Q marker。以UPLC分别对多批当归药材中的Q-marker进行含量测定,建立其NIRS定量模型,并进一步将Q-marker的含量与当归的NF-κB抑制活性相关联,构建“量-效”拟合函数。结果表明,绿原酸(X1)、洋川芎内酯I(X3)和Z-藁本内酯(X4)为NF-κB抑制活性的关键Q-marker,其含量波动与整体抗炎活性(Y)的变化相吻合,符合拟合方程:Y=16.13-1484X1+7.981X3+0.112 6X4,且基于NIRS的预测效果良好。该方法通过整合分析实现了基于关键Q-marker的当归药材抗炎功效的快速评价,为中药材品质的快速分析提供了新的研究范式和解决方案。
By screening the quality markers(Q-markers) of NF-κB inhibitory active ingredients,a method of near infrared spectroscopy(NIRS) was established for the rapid evaluation of anti inflammatory effect of Angelica sinensis(AS).The NF-κB inhibitory active ingredients in AS were screened by UPLC/Q-TOF combined with NF-κB double luciferase reporter gene assay system.To establish the Q-markers,the inhibitory effects were further evaluated using active ingredients,AS extract and equivalence verification.The Q-markers in multi batches of AS were quantitatively analyzed by UPLC and NIRS,and then the NIRS fitting algorithm was established.Meanwhile,the relationship between NF-κB inhibitory holistic activity of AS extract and the content of Q-markers was investigated.Finally,the prediction model for anti-inflammatory efficacy of AS was constructed based on Q-markers check analysis via NIRS technique.The screening results showed that chlorogenic acid(X1),senkyunolide I(X3) and Z-ligustilide(X4) in AS had significant NF-κB inhibitory effects,and the change of content was consistent with the capacity of NF-κB inhibitory action of AS extracts,which satisfied the following functions:Y=16.13-14.84X1+7.981X3+0.112 6X4.In addition,the measured values from NIRS simulation method for the Q-markers detection showed a good correlation with the predicted values.The developed method realized the rapid evaluation on the anti-inflammatory effects of AS based on Q-markers,and provided a new research paradigm and solution for the rapid quality evaluation of traditional Chinese medicine.
